The cruel effects of war on the innocent.
Rag doll, rag doll
Small and adorn
With figs and cotton
Left on the floor.
A gun shot down
Four angels in the sky.
I wonder where we all sleep tonight.
The wind speaks to wolves
Who cry for rag doll
Left on the ground.
Rag doll, rag doll
Who shall comfort you
With the warmth of a blanket
To love your soul?
I hear a pin drop
And a grenade explodes.
Nothing could be done
But look to the light
That follows us around
While clinging to the rag doll
Left on the ground.
